What is a dental implant?

A dental implant an artificial tooth (or teeth) root which is placed in the mouth, which is made of titanium metal. It is fixed in the jawbone and becomes a permanent fixture in the mouth to support a dental bridge or denture.

Implants are the replacement of missing tooth root

A void is created where the root is situated when someone loses their tooth. But most of the tooth replacement treatments only focus on replacing the crown of the teeth. But dental implants also focus on the other parts of the teeth which are not visible. These parts include the roots or the sub-level. Roots are generally anchored with the jaw of the person and work similarly as the roots do for the tree. With the help of a dental implant, a natural bond is created between the mental and the bone. One can end up losing the jawbone mass and density over the period of time without dental implant in the root position

Implants keep the teeth healthy

A dental bridge is the most widely used method to replace the missing tooth. But this requires cutting some parts of the adjacent teeth, which might be healthy to ensure the proper balance of the dental bridge. But with the help of the dental implant, the dentist can position the crown or a bridge on the dental implant itself, without harming other teeth. Dental implants ensure healthy teeth stay healthy while going under dental surgery.
